The U.S. Transportation Security Administration (TSA) announced on Friday that it will implement new, more stringent identification requirements at U.S. airports starting May 7, cautioning that passengers without compliant IDs may be denied boarding.

Beginning May 7, TSA will no longer accept state-issued IDs that do not meet REAL ID standards. While Congress approved stricter federal regulations for ID issuance back in 2005, enforcement of these rules has been delayed multiple times.
On Friday, TSA announced that starting next month, passengers aged 18 and older who lack passports or enhanced identification may experience delays, undergo extra screening, and potentially be denied entry to the security checkpoint.
The extent to which TSA will enforce the new regulations remains uncertain. U.S. airlines are already facing concerns about reduced demand due to international tariff issues and broader economic challenges.
In December 2022, TSA delayed the enforcement deadline for “REAL ID” requirements, extending it until May 2025.
The 2005 law implemented the recommendation of the September 11, 2001, commission, urging the U.S. government to establish standards for issuing identification documents, including driver’s licenses. The law sets basic security requirements for the issuance and production of these IDs.
